The Anarchists of the Russian Revolution, by Paul Avrich

Paul Avrich, an influential historian renowned for his insights on anarchism and the Russian Revolution, discusses the ambitions of early 20th-century Russian anarchists. He delves into their vision for a social revolution and the rise of various ideological factions after the February 1917 rebellion. The conversation highlights the significant split between anarchist communists and anarcho-syndicalists, which weakened their movement and paved the way for the Bolsheviks. Avrich also uncovers the complex relationship between anarchists and Bolsheviks, showcasing their initial collaboration and later conflict.

Anarchism in Korea by Dongyoun Hwang

Dongyoun Hwang, an expert on Korean anarchism, delves into the rich history of anarchism in Korea. He discusses its pivotal role in the early 20th century independence movement against Japanese colonialism. Listeners will discover the formation of influential anarchist groups and their connections to global movements. Hwang highlights the relentless fight for political freedom and social change, painting a vivid picture of how these ideals shaped Korea's struggle for independence.

Green Scared Lessons from the FBI Crackdown on Eco-Activists

For questions, comments or to get involved, e-mail us at audibleanarchist(at)gmail.com Text can be read at https://theanarchistlibrary.org/libra...   This essay examines the effects of a law enforcement campaign against environmental activists and Anarchists in the Pacific North West. "The Green Scare is legal action by the US government against the radical environmental movement, that occurred mostly in the 2000s. It alludes to the Red Scares, periods of fear over communist infiltration of US society. "
